diff options
author | Anselm R. Garbe <arg@suckless.org> | 2007-01-10 12:54:23 +0100 |
---|---|---|
committer | Anselm R. Garbe <arg@suckless.org> | 2007-01-10 12:54:23 +0100 |
commit | 653826572d5dfe36fc567b2fdce7ef5d9ad0bfbc (patch) | |
tree | 55b5042461307812813d6ed59690204bb30d0097 /event.c | |
parent | 5a5851bac2670624f30c84efe4129f0101f62255 (diff) | |
download | dwm-653826572d5dfe36fc567b2fdce7ef5d9ad0bfbc.tar.gz |
added comment to %u in config.default.h, added Button{4.5} support on mode label
Diffstat (limited to 'event.c')
-rw-r--r-- | event.c | 16 |
1 files changed, 14 insertions, 2 deletions
diff --git a/event.c b/event.c index c9ad387..2deef14 100644 --- a/event.c +++ b/event.c @@ -131,8 +131,20 @@ buttonpress(XEvent *e) { return; } } - if((ev->x < x + bmw) && (ev->button == Button1)) - togglemode(NULL); + if(ev->x < x + bmw) + switch(ev->button) { + case Button1: + togglemode(NULL); + break; + case Button4: + a.i = 1; + incnmaster(&a); + break; + case Button5: + a.i = -1; + incnmaster(&a); + break; + } } else if((c = getclient(ev->window))) { focus(c); |